The Failsafe Program: An Alan Harrison and Layla Novel
Overview
One unmarked package. One sentient AI. Three murders. Failure could rewrite reality itself.
Alan Harrison is content with his routine life as a research analyst for a major insurance firm. His days are predictable: reviewing data, tackling endless emails, and handling routine accident claims.
Then, the unpredictable arrives: an unmarked package delivered by a courier with no return address.
Inside is Layla, a sleek, palm-sized device housing an autonomous, multi-modal neural architecture. She is brilliant, capable of bypassing firewalls, cracking military-grade encryption, and analyzing petabytes of data in seconds. She is also mysterious, arriving with no memory of her creator or her purpose.
Layla is a puzzle Alan intends to solve. But when their investigation exposes a dark secret: Layla is a powerful AI prototype, and someone is willing to kill to get their hands on her.
Now, Alan is no longer an analyst; he’s an investigator on the run, partnered with a voice in his ear who reveals the terrifying stakes:
“The very reality of our world [is] at risk.”
Hunted by an unknown adversary, Alan and Layla must race to uncover a corporate conspiracy involving advanced artificial intelligence technology. Their quest pits a former insurance drone and his digital sidekick against the most advanced minds in the technology industry.
If Alan can’t learn to trust a machine, he might lose more than his life—he might lose his reality.
